    According to research on alcohol advertising, there is not a strong connection between ads for alcohol and alcohol consumption and abuse in Prairie City, Oregon. That does not hold true for their effects on children. Research indicates that children that are exposed to alcohol-related advertisements in Prairie City, Oregon are more prone to start drinking at a younger age and to look upon drinking alcohol as a positive thing. This also translates to a higher number of children in Prairie City, Oregon who grow up to be alcohol drinkers.
